Her benefactor was Rupert D'Oyly Carte, a member of the family that first produced Gilbert and Sullivan operas in London and that built the Savoy Hotel. There has long been speculation that Coley mentored Harry Craddock at the Savoy, as their time overlapped for a period of about five years, before Craddock left prohibition-era America for greener pastures. Coleman told the story behind the creation of the Hanky-Panky to England's The People newspaper in 1925: The late Charles Hawtrey ... was one of the best judges of cocktails that I knew. When Rupert became chairman of the Savoy, Ada was given a position at the hotel's American Bar, where she eventually became the head bartender and made cocktails for the likes of Mark Twain, the Prince of Wales, Prince Wilhelm of Sweden, and Sir Charles Hawtrey.
